Job Description
The individual selected for this role will be expected to work at Store#3232, located at: 3902 Circle Dr, Holmen, WI 54636.
This position is responsible for spray equipment (e.g. airless, conventional, electrostatic, pressure washers) at the store or at customers’ job sites. This includes performing necessary repairs, providing training on equipment, and maintaining inventory as required. Responsibilities- Support the sales efforts at a Sherwin-Williams paint store, servicing wholesale and retail customers.
- Perform repairs on all types of spray equipment (e.g. airless, conventional, electrostatic, pressure washers.) at the store or at customers’ job sites.
- Conduct hydraulic and warranty repairs.
- Rebuild pumps.
- Repair branch tinting and mixing equipment.
- Educate other employees and customers on spray equipment.
- Maintain an inventory of spray parts.
